2025 Fantasy Outlook
Lozano was the biggest name signing for San Diego heading into their first MLS campaign, coming over from Champions League-regulars PSV. The left winger has the potential to immediately be one of the best players in MLS, but he likely won't have the supporting cast to really pop on the scoresheet. Marcus Ingvartsen appears set to lead the line, and while he's a competent finisher, Lozano will have to carry more of the weight as a creator and finisher in this side. Lozano's upside is unquestionable, but with any expansion team, there are uncertainties around what San Diego will look like in 2025.

Gets assist on plenty of service
Lozano assisted once to go with five shots (two on goal), 10 crosses (six accurate) and six corners in Saturday's 3-1 loss against Minnesota United.
ANALYSIS
Lozano was quite accurate with his service and he ultimately did get an assist, but there wasn't much San Diego could do about Dayne St. Clair's effort in goal. Lozano should maintain this volume and productivity against Atlanta United, a team which has allowed 54 goals in 29 MLS games.

Will complete MLS move
Lozano is set to sign with San Diego FC, according to ESPN.
ANALYSIS
Lozano is happy in the Eredivisie, but he's also keen on moving stateside to join an expansion side that will debut in 2025. Lozano would become the team's first Designated Player and is expected to be a star with the club.
